San Francisco: The Heart of Tech Innovation
- Best Seasons: Spring (March-May) and Fall (September-November) are ideal, with mild weather and fewer tourists.
- Getting There: San Francisco International Airport (SFO) is a major hub, just 20 minutes from downtown.
New York: The City That Never Sleeps
- Best Seasons: Late Spring (May-June) and Early Fall (September-October) offer great weather and vibrant city life.
- Getting There: Three major airports (JFK, LaGuardia, Newark) provide easy access to the city.

Budget Breakdown for a Typical Tech Retreat
For a 20-person team, here's a typical budget breakdown:
- Venue: $3,600 (40% of total)
- F&B: $2,250 (25%)
- Activities: $1,350 (15%)
- Travel: $1,350 (15%)
- Contingency: $450 (5%)
Total Estimated Cost: $9,000 (approximately $450/person)

Timeline for Planning Your Tech Retreat
8-12 Weeks Out
- Choose Your City: Decide between San Francisco and New York.
- Budget Planning: Finalize your budget.
- Venue Selection: Research and shortlist venues.
- Book Venue: Confirm bookings to secure dates.
4-8 Weeks Out
- Catering Coordination: Finalize meal options with the venue.
- Activity Booking: Reserve any offsite activities.
- Travel Arrangements: Coordinate flights and accommodations.
1-4 Weeks Out
- Finalize Agenda: Confirm speakers and session topics.
- Team Communication: Send out itineraries to participants.
- Last-Minute Checks: Confirm all arrangements with vendors.
